- 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
- 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多
开发规范说明书
目录
TOC \o 1-3 \h \z \u 第一章 概述 5
第二章 命名规范 6
2 程序命名规范 6
2.1.1 命名空间 6
2.1.2 页面命名 6
2.1.3 类 7
2.1.4 控件 8
2.1.5 方法 8
2.1.6 控件事件 8
2.1.7 变量命名 9
2.2 数据库命名规范 9
2.2.1 表 9
2.2.2 主键、外键 10
2.2.3 索引 10
2.2.4 字段 10
2.2.5 视图 10
2.2.6 存储过程 11
2.2.7 函数 12
2.2.8 包 12
2.2.9 触发器 12
2.2.10 序列 12
2.2.11 参数 13
2.2.12 变量 13
第三章 编程风格 14
3.1 程序注释 14
3.1.1 类 14
3.1.2 属性 14
3.1.3 方法、事件 14
3.1.4 JS文件中方法 15
3.1.5 页面JS方法 15
3.2 数据库注释 16
3.2.1 视图 16
3.2.2 存储过程、函数 16
3.2.3 包 17
3.2.4 触发器 17
3.2.5 变量 18
3.3 代码编排风格 18
3.4 异常的产生、传递、处理 20
3.5 变量的声明和作用域 21
3.6 框架各层 22
3.6.1 Model层 23
3.6.2 EntityDAL层 23
3.6.3 Interface层 25
3.6.4 BusFactory层 26
3.6.5 WebService层 28
3.6.6 Web层 28
第四章 界面设计 29
4.1 屏幕分辨率、IE、色彩 29
4.2 页面编排要求 29
4.2.1 Table布局 29
4.2.2 Frame布局 31
4.2.3 字体 32
4.2.4 图标、图片 32
4.2.5 颜色 32
4.2.6 文字对齐方式 33
4.2.7 Tab键顺序 34
4.2.8 工具栏 34
4.2.9 按钮 36
4.2.10 页框 37
4.2.11 必录入项设置 38
4.2.12 编辑控件长度设置 38
4.3 控件使用要求 39
4.3.1 按钮 39
4.3.2 下拉按钮 39
4.3.3 下拉选择 40
4.3.4 日期选择 40
4.3.5 英文输入 41
4.3.6 数字输入 41
4.3.7 文本输入 41
4.3.8 弹出选择 42
4.3.9 查询条件控件 42
4.3.10 列表控件 43
4.4 窗口布局 44
4.4.1 单列表 44
4.4.2 左右列表 44
4.4.3 上下列表 45
4.4.4 单树 45
4.4.5 左树右列表 45
4.4.6 弹出窗口 45
4.4.7 其他 45
4.5 提示信息 46
4.5.1 提示信息捕获原则 46
4.5.2 提示信息分类 46
显性错误 46
.1 控件提示 46
.2 控制性提示 47
.3 误操作性提示 47
.4 询问性提示 48
.5 错误性提示 48
隐性错误 48
第五章 开发注意要点 49
第六章 附录 50
6.1 Base公共方法、属性列表 50
6.2 项目使用图标列表 51
6.3 系统保留字列表 52
6.4 类型简称列表(数据、数据库、类缩写) 53
6.5 Excel导出模板示例 55
6.6 自定义控件引用标识列表 55
6.7 常用控件缩写列表 56
6.8 常用功能按钮名称列表 57
概述
在建设过程中,将涉及到在新的.Net以及Java平台上的开发工作。同时,设计人员、开发人员和测试人员较多。为了使应用程序的结构和编码风格标准化,便于阅读和理解编码,以提高开发效率和产品的标准化,制订一套开发规范和标准势在必行。此外,好的编码约定可使源代码严谨、可读性强且意义清楚,与其它语言约定相一致,并且尽可能的直观。
文档评论(0)